写在前面本系列为DDR3控制器设计总结,此系列包含DDR3控制器相关设计:认识MIG、初始化、读写操作、FIFO接口等。通过此系列的学习可以加深对DDR3读写时序的理解以及FIFO接口设计等,附上汇总博客直达链接。【DDR3控制器设计】系列博客汇总篇(附直达链接)目录实验任务实验环境实验介绍
写在前面本系列为DDR3控制器设计总结,此系列包含DDR3控制器相关设计:认识MIG、初始化、读写操作、FIFO接口等。通过此系列的学习可以加深对DDR3读写时序的理解以及FIFO接口设计等,附上汇总博客直达链接。【DDR3控制器设计】系列博客汇总篇(附直达链接)目录实验任务实验环境实验介绍
基于“PC+运动控制器”结构的开放式机器人运动控制系统能够充分利用PC开放程度高、通用性好、处理能力强等特点以及运动控制器运算速度快、实时性能好、控制能力强等特点,因此得到较快发展,成为目前的研究热点。但目前采用此种结构的开放式机器人运动控制系统中,不管是控制器供应商所提供的运动控制器或者是科研人员自主设计的运动控制器,在通用性、软硬件可重构方面都存在一些问题,影响着机器人运动控制系统的开放性。因此,本文通过研究开放式机器人运动控制器的结构特点,制定了基于DSP+FPGA的开放式机器人运动控制器的总体设计方案。根据所制定的设计方案,设计并实现了基于DSP+FPGA的开放式机器人运动控制器,并研
基于“PC+运动控制器”结构的开放式机器人运动控制系统能够充分利用PC开放程度高、通用性好、处理能力强等特点以及运动控制器运算速度快、实时性能好、控制能力强等特点,因此得到较快发展,成为目前的研究热点。但目前采用此种结构的开放式机器人运动控制系统中,不管是控制器供应商所提供的运动控制器或者是科研人员自主设计的运动控制器,在通用性、软硬件可重构方面都存在一些问题,影响着机器人运动控制系统的开放性。因此,本文通过研究开放式机器人运动控制器的结构特点,制定了基于DSP+FPGA的开放式机器人运动控制器的总体设计方案。根据所制定的设计方案,设计并实现了基于DSP+FPGA的开放式机器人运动控制器,并研
电子电气架构车载网关系列——典型网关介绍(NXPS32G274A)我是穿拖鞋的汉子,魔都中坚持长期主义的一个屌丝工程师!今天继续分享网关相关事宜——典型网关介绍(NXPS32G274A)。NXPS32汽车平台是面向汽车和工业应用的微控制器和处理器,提供了可平衡高性能和高功效的架构。这些产品旨在应对当前和未来的连接、功能安全和信息安全的挑战。而S32G家族可实现高性能、功能安全和信息安全的处理,适用于服务型网关、域控制器、区域处理器、车载计算机和安全处理器等领域。配备了安全可靠的多核ArmCortex-A53应用处理器,可选配的集群锁步支持。另外配备了双锁步核Cortex-M7的实时微控制器;同
电子电气架构车载网关系列——典型网关介绍(NXPS32G274A)我是穿拖鞋的汉子,魔都中坚持长期主义的一个屌丝工程师!今天继续分享网关相关事宜——典型网关介绍(NXPS32G274A)。NXPS32汽车平台是面向汽车和工业应用的微控制器和处理器,提供了可平衡高性能和高功效的架构。这些产品旨在应对当前和未来的连接、功能安全和信息安全的挑战。而S32G家族可实现高性能、功能安全和信息安全的处理,适用于服务型网关、域控制器、区域处理器、车载计算机和安全处理器等领域。配备了安全可靠的多核ArmCortex-A53应用处理器,可选配的集群锁步支持。另外配备了双锁步核Cortex-M7的实时微控制器;同
本文档是基于FPGAK7SATAIP控制器的SATA接口调试记录,接口遵循标准的ACHI协议。操作系统内核版本:5.4.18由于K7PCIE只有3个bar,AHCI协议规定SATA控制器是在第四个BAR上,另外由于PCIE配置空间设备类寄存器和能力寄存器未配置成sata设备,导致系统自带的驱动不能没生效。因此需要修改系统sata驱动并重新编译安装。Sata驱动在内核目录/drivers/ata/下,对于ahcisata对于的驱动文件是ahci.c,单独编译ahci文件需要对该目录下的Makefile文件进行如下修改:SPDX-License-Identifier:GPL-2.0#将ahci.c
本文档是基于FPGAK7SATAIP控制器的SATA接口调试记录,接口遵循标准的ACHI协议。操作系统内核版本:5.4.18由于K7PCIE只有3个bar,AHCI协议规定SATA控制器是在第四个BAR上,另外由于PCIE配置空间设备类寄存器和能力寄存器未配置成sata设备,导致系统自带的驱动不能没生效。因此需要修改系统sata驱动并重新编译安装。Sata驱动在内核目录/drivers/ata/下,对于ahcisata对于的驱动文件是ahci.c,单独编译ahci文件需要对该目录下的Makefile文件进行如下修改:SPDX-License-Identifier:GPL-2.0#将ahci.c
ASP.NETMVC-控制器为了学习ASP.NETMVC,我们将构建一个Internet应用程序。第4部分:添加控制器。Controllers文件夹Controllers文件夹包含负责处理用户输入和响应的控制类。MVC要求所有控制器文件的名称以"Controller"结尾。在我们的实例中,VisualWebDeveloper已经创建好了以下文件:HomeController.cs(用于Home页面和About页面)和AccountController.cs(用于登录页面):Web服务器通常会将进入的URL请求直接映射到服务器上的磁盘文件。例如:URL请求"http://www.w3cschoo
ASP.NETMVC-控制器为了学习ASP.NETMVC,我们将构建一个Internet应用程序。第4部分:添加控制器。Controllers文件夹Controllers文件夹包含负责处理用户输入和响应的控制类。MVC要求所有控制器文件的名称以"Controller"结尾。在我们的实例中,VisualWebDeveloper已经创建好了以下文件:HomeController.cs(用于Home页面和About页面)和AccountController.cs(用于登录页面):Web服务器通常会将进入的URL请求直接映射到服务器上的磁盘文件。例如:URL请求"http://www.w3cschoo